I bought an A1 model from amazon last year. I had a problem with the blade on my 3rd day of a 40+ day wilderness survival course. Contacted the company by email. They all but accused me of trying to pull a fast one over on them. Then accused me of abusing the knife (the "survival" knife). Then they asked for proof of purchase and said if the vendor was not on their tiny list of authorized dealers that they probably wouldnt honor the warranty. At which point I sent 1 final and unpleasant email to the company telling them what they can do with the remainder of their day and logged into amazon to purchase a Tops BoB knife for the rest of my course. The A1 felt much better in hand, but I could baton wood with my BoB without the edge bending. I could have just gotten a miserable employee cooresponding with me and my A1 couldve been an oddity defect (general consensus in camp was it was genuine vg10 since it didnt rust, but the heat treatment was off), regardless I wont spend another dollar on the company.

T222T222Similar thing happened to me but with an S1 on the first day using it. Genuine blade. Stuck the tip into a block of wood and the point shattered off. Clear dark line in the steel at the break. Their answer was to grind a new point millimeters shorter and hand it back. Didn’t even try to match the belly profile. My take, these blades are not worth the price with service like that.
